| Summary: | Cities, War and Terrorism is the first book to look critically at the ways in which warfare, terrorism and counter-terrorism policies intersect in cities in the post Cold-War period. A path-breaking exploration of the intersections of war, terrorism and citiesArgues that contemporary cities are the key strategic sites of geopolitical conflictWritten by the world & rsquo;s leading analysts of the intersections of urban space and military and terrorist violenceDraws on cutting-edge research from geography, history, architecture, planning, sociology, critical theory, politics, international relation. |
